Aimed at young creators aged 6-12, the workshops are focused on themes such as Entertainment, Space, Imagination and Gaming. Super playful creativity workshops for kids, led by unstoppable creators.
Creativity Workshops – the first workshop will have an entertainment theme and will be held at LEGO Toy Shop Leeds – Trinity Leeds Albion Street on 21st and 28th April. This workshop allows young creators to celebrate their star power by building a photo frame with in which they can display a picture of an achievement, friends, family or anything they want to celebrate. Store associates will be on hand to help guide the creators with their build.
Creativity at Home – online workshops hosted by creative innovators, starting with dancing sensation Dianne Buswell who will show you and your family how you can create fun LEGO builds to decorate your home – including a name sign, photo frame and jewellery stand.
